Title of article :
Rheology of oil-in-water emulsions containing fine particles

Abstract :
The effect of fine solids on the viscosity of oil-in-water emulsions was investigated. The emulsion–solid mixtures were prepared from oils having viscosities of 20, 60, and 220 mPa s with the addition of 0–2% particles. The relative viscosities of the emulsion–solid mixtures were functions of the oil and solids, and the shear rate. General equations commonly used in the literature could not predict the viscosity of the emulsion–solid mixtures. The relative viscosities at high shear rates (≥450 s−1) could be correlated by ηr=exp[(b×ln(ϕo)+c)×ϕs], where b equals 85 and c ranges from 195 to 208.
